Moral injury as a mediator of the associations between sexual harassment and mental health symptoms and substance use among women veterans - Hamrick HC, Ehlke SJ, Davies RL, Higgins JM, Naylor J, Kelley ML.

Moral injury is an array of symptoms theorized to develop in response to morally injurious events, defined as events that challenge one's core moral beliefs and expectations about the self, others, and world. Recent measures of moral injury have distingu...
